Erin Fezell is the owner of KeyHolder Creations, a vintage inspired hand drawn 3D printed jewelry company based out of Nashville, Tennessee. She started her business with her first 3D printer in September 2016.
She never could quite find a fitting solution for her business. 3D printing seemed like the right fit but it was also a pipe dream due to cost.
She found her first 3D printer in a clearance section at a big box store - a $1500 competitor printer for $9.98! So as you can imagine, she couldn't pass that up. While her first 3D printer was definitely of value for what it taught her, it did come with a cost. It was a closed source printer, the build platform was super small, and anything that she printed required a raft. She could not modify any of the print settings to go with any various filament types nor were replacing parts much of an option. All of this resulted in a product that was rough on one side, would take hours to clean up after a print, and was just an embarrassing example of what 3D printing can do.

As the popularity of her products grew, so did her need for a better machine.
She had been searching for months and debating on the right 3D printer for her business. She wanted something that provided the most features for her budget but still gave the business room to grow. She also needed the ability to control her prints more than the current system allowed.
With the Craftbots, she was able to use the included slicer (Craftware) or any third-party software. She could modify temp/speed/other various settings, mid-print on the touchscreen, also her prints are saved in case there are any power outages (the printer will give the option to carry on the print when power is restored), and the parts are easy to repair/replace without expensive ‘all in one’ pieces.
